Output f74b75ac6881f991d8ba644cd62680a0542780f9b68e01997798cb5942af8e27:1

value
17992727
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 135487166ff10d5e56b7fed554ccb28e79e6469a OP_EQUALVERIFY OP_CHECKSIG
address
12mD6jRLLdPfoPL2KnznJyCQyB88euxmgL
transaction
f74b75ac6881f991d8ba644cd62680a0542780f9b68e01997798cb5942af8e27
confirmations
750088
spent
true